#61194C Color
#61194C is rgb(97, 25, 76) in RGB, hsl(318, 59%, 24%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 74%, 22%, 62%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Palatinate Purple (#682860),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.81.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#61194C Channel Values
How #61194C bre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 97 · G 25 · B 76 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 318° · S 59% · L 24%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 318° · S 74% · V 38%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 74% · Y 22% · K 62%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 11.99:1 vs white · 1.75: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#61194C background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#61194C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#61194C?
#61194C is a dark pink — rgb(97, 25, 76) in RGB and hsl(318, 59%, 24%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Palatinate Purple (#682860),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.81.
What is the RGB value of #61194C?
#61194C is rgb(97, 25, 76) — red 97, green 25, and blue 76 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#61194C?
#61194C conver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 74%, 22%, 62%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#61194C be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#61194C scores 11.99:1 against white and 1.75: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#61194C as a CSS color keyword?
No. #61194C is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is purple (#800080) at a CIE76 distance of 30.67, which is a different colour altogether.
